Yellow Crane Tower: A Cultural and Architectural Marvel
Founded in AD 223 during the Three Kingdoms period, this tower has long been revered as one of China’s top historic sites. It’s often called the “Finest Under Heaven,” and for good reason. Standing on the site, you’re treated to sweeping views of Wuhan’s skyline and the Yangtze River, with the tower itself offering a glimpse into ancient Chinese architecture and poetic legend.
The guide will likely share stories about Sun Quan’s original watchtower and how the current structure has been rebuilt and restored over centuries. For many visitors, the highlight is the bird’s-eye view of Wuhan city, which reveals a blend of historic buildings and modern high-rises sprawling in every direction.
The Sky Train Experience
After soaking in the history, it’s time to hop aboard the Optical Valley Sky Train—a suspended, fully automatic monorail that’s as much about technology as it is about sightseeing. With a capacity for over 200 passengers and a design that emphasizes scientific innovation, green ecology, and Jingchu culture, it’s a contemporary marvel.
The train runs along a 10.5-kilometer route with six stations, each offering unique views and local scenery. Its 270° panoramic windows create an almost 360-degree experience, making every moment on board feel like an aerial tour of Wuhan’s urban landscape. The train’s top speed of 60 km/h means you’ll feel the thrill of smooth, swift travel, while appreciating sights such as the Yangtze River Bridge and the city’s modern skyline from above.
Many reviewers mention that the train’s design allows for a ‘one station, one scenery’ approach, giving you a sense of discovery at each stop. The line’s thematic integration—emphasizing eco-friendliness and local culture—adds a layer of meaning to your ride, transforming it from a simple commute into a cultural experience.
